The Sony WH-1000XM3 headphones are renowned for their exceptional sound quality and noise-canceling capabilities. However, with prolonged use, the ear pads may deteriorate, affecting both comfort and sound performance. Replacing the ear pads is a relatively simple task that can restore your headphones to their former glory. This comprehensive guide will provide step-by-step instructions on how to replace ear pads on Sony WH-1000XM3 headphones, ensuring a seamless and satisfying experience.

Materials Required

Before embarking on the replacement process, gather the following materials:

  • Replacement ear pads for Sony WH-1000XM3
  • Small flathead screwdriver or plastic pry tool
  • Soft cloth

Safety Precautions

Before handling the headphones, ensure they are turned off and disconnected from any power source. Handle the headphones with care to avoid damaging sensitive components.

Step-by-Step Instructions

1. Remove the Old Ear Pads

  • Use the flathead screwdriver or pry tool to gently pry the outer edge of the old ear pad away from the headphone housing.
  • Continue prying around the circumference of the ear pad until it is completely detached.
  • Repeat the process for the other ear pad.

2. Clean the Headphone Housing

  • Use a soft cloth to remove any dirt or debris from the headphone housing where the ear pads were attached.
  • This will ensure a clean surface for the new ear pads to adhere to.

3. Align the New Ear Pads

  • Align the new ear pads with the corresponding slots on the headphone housing.
  • Ensure that the “L” and “R” markings on the ear pads match the corresponding sides of the headphones.

4. Snap the Ear Pads into Place

  • Starting from one end, carefully press the new ear pad into the slots on the headphone housing.
  • Continue pressing around the circumference until the ear pad is securely snapped into place.
  • Repeat the process for the other ear pad.

5. Check for Secure Fit

  • Gently pull on the new ear pads to ensure they are firmly attached.
  • If any ear pad feels loose, remove it and reinsert it, applying more pressure during the snapping process.

6. Test the Headphones

  • Put on the headphones and play some music to test the sound quality and comfort.
  • Ensure that the noise cancellation is working effectively and that the sound is clear and balanced.

Troubleshooting

Loose Ear Pads: If the ear pads feel loose after replacement, remove them and reinsert them, applying more pressure during the snapping process.

Uneven Sound: If the sound is uneven or muffled after replacing the ear pads, check if they are properly aligned and securely attached.

Damaged Ear Pads: If the ear pads are damaged or torn, replace them immediately to prevent further damage to the headphones.

Tips for Optimal Performance

  • Use high-quality replacement ear pads specifically designed for Sony WH-1000XM3 headphones.
  • Replace the ear pads regularly to maintain optimal sound quality and comfort.
  • Clean the ear pads and headphone housing periodically to remove dirt and debris.
  • Store the headphones in a protective case when not in use to prevent damage to the ear pads.

FAQ

Q1. How often should I replace the ear pads on my Sony WH-1000XM3 headphones?
A. The frequency of replacement depends on usage and care. Generally, it is recommended to replace the ear pads every 6-12 months.

Q2. Can I use ear pads from other headphones on my Sony WH-1000XM3?
A. No, it is not recommended to use ear pads from other headphones as they may not fit properly or provide optimal performance.

Q3. Can I replace the ear pads on my Sony WH-1000XM3 headphones under warranty?
A. Ear pads are typically not covered under warranty. However, if the ear pads are defective or damaged within the warranty period, you may be eligible for a replacement.
